Zatiaľ čo bezpečnostný systém zahrnutý v OS X, Gatekeeper, robí niečo, čo nám bráni v aktualizácii určitých aplikácií alebo priamo zakazuje ich vykonávanie, k tomu čiastočne dochádza, pretože program, či už podpísaný alebo nepodpísaný vývojárom, bol upravený neskôr a táto akcia zabráni malvéru vstúpiť do systému, čo bude mať za následok „varovnú“ správu, ktorá nás upozorní aplikácia je poškodená a že by to malo byť presunuté do koša.
Na druhej strane tento typ upozornenia na poškodenú aplikáciu nemá vstavanú možnosť obísť ochranu na rozdiel od podpísané žiadosti kde, ak by sme to mohli urobiť jednoducho kliknutím na Otvoriť «pravým tlačidlom» alebo zmenou systémových preferencií.
Táto funkcia môže byť veľmi užitočná, ak sa budeme držať najprísnejšej bezpečnostnej roviny, ale môže to byť aj frustrujúce, pretože niektoré programy sa sami upravujú, keď bežia automaticky na pozadí alebo dokonca manuálne bez toho, aby si to uvedomovali, čo vedie k tomu, že vývojár môže program legitímne zverejniť. aktualizovať, ak je podpísaná, ale že v čase overenia môže spustiť falošné pozitívum preskočenie varovania „aplikácia je poškodená“.
Jednou z možností by bolo čakať na pevnú a testovanú verziu, ktorá funguje správne s Gatekeeper a ktorý bol predtým testovanýMôže to však trvať dlhšie, ako je potrebné, a nemusí to byť najlepšia cesta.
Na druhej strane, ak poznáme verziu programu, ktorá je blokovaný Existuje spôsob, ako tento problém prekonať, a to vytvoriť výnimku v službe Gatekeeper. Za týmto účelom vytvoríme sadu pravidiel týkajúcich sa aktualizácie tejto aplikácie pomocou niekoľkých jednoduchých príkazov terminálu:
- Otvorte terminál a zadajte nasledujúce
spctl --add --štítok "NAME"
- Vo vyššie uvedenom príkaze nahradíme „NAME“ štítkom, ktorý chcete pre dané pravidlo, napríklad „EXCEL“, ak odkazujeme na Microsoft Excel.
- Potom sa musíme uistiť, že zachovávame medzery a príkaz bol správne definovaný, aby sme dokončili dokončenie trasy:
spctl --add - štítok "NÁZOV" / Aplikácie / Program \ Priečinok / Program.app
Vďaka tomu teraz môžeme bez problémov spustiť aplikáciu, pretože Gatekeeper zaznamená výnimka pre konkrétny program.
Viac informácií - Zmeňte počet posledných súborov zobrazených v OSX
Mali by ste lepšie vysvetliť postup.
„Aby sme to my Mongoli, ktorí používajú MacOS, rozumeli,“ nepridali ste.
Po vykonaní indikovanej inštrukcie dostávam stále tú istú chybu, aplikácia je stále „poškodená“ a nedá sa otvoriť. To je neznesiteľné, táto vec so systémom MacOS sa stáva neprípustnou, nakoniec skončím s migráciou späť na Windows 10. Našťastie ma Parallels zachráni.